Try setting:
attributePrefix="HTTP_"
with:
useVariables="true" useHeaders="false"
just a thought.
On Thu, Apr 23, 2020 at 2:50 PM user1630508 <pgrandsard at pagepath.com> wrote:
> Are we talking past each other for what's considered a server variable?
>
> With useVariables="true" useHeaders="false",
> Request.ServerVariables["HTTP_SHIBIDENTITYPROVIDER"] (or any HTTP_SHIB) is
> not passed back to to .net.
> Setting useHeaders="true" does allow them to be passed back.
>
> What would be a .net header call vs a .net variable call?
